👏 CCAD Launches New Program Offering Free Tuition For Many Central Ohio Students
Columbus College of Art & Design just launched Creative Pathway, a program that will cover remaining tuition for many local students beginning in 2026. It’s a major win for young artists in central Ohio who want a top-tier creative education without the debt.
🍻 A Pre-Prohibition Beer Barrel Is About to Make Its Big Comeback in Columbus
Hoster Brewing is giving Columbus beer lovers a rare look into the past as they unveil a pre-Prohibition beer barrel and tap a reimagined historic lager. The free event on Dec. 10 features a short talk from a Hoster descendant, plenty of beer, and a food truck on site.

🧑⚖️ Environmental groups are suing Ohio over the legislature’s decision to remove the long-standing Air Nuisance Rule from the state’s clean air plan, a move they say was unconstitutionally tucked into the budget. The state argues the change is valid, but advocates warn it strips Ohioans of a key tool to hold polluters accountable in federal court.(NBC4)
🏛️ The National Veterans Memorial and Museum has a new leader, and he’s got big plans. CEO Frederic Bertley says the museum is tightening its budget, rethinking how to draw visitors, and doubling down on telling veterans’ stories in a way that actually connects with Columbus. (WOSU)
